Installation
Plugin Installation (Recommended)
BASH
# Add marketplace
/plugin marketplace add lackeyjb/playwright-skill
# Install plugin
/plugin install playwright-skill@playwright-skill
# Run setup
cd ~/.claude/plugins/marketplaces/playwright-skill/skills/playwright-skill
npm run setup
Standalone Installation
BASH
# Clone to temp location
git clone https://github.com/lackeyjb/playwright-skill.git /tmp/playwright-skill-temp
# Copy skill folder
mkdir -p ~/.claude/skills
cp -r /tmp/playwright-skill-temp/skills/playwright-skill ~/.claude/skills/
# Run setup
cd ~/.claude/skills/playwright-skill
npm run setup
# Cleanup
rm -rf /tmp/playwright-skill-temp
Configuration
| Setting |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Headless | false | Browser visible unless requested otherwise |
| Slow Motion | 100ms | For visibility during execution |
| Timeout | 30s | Default timeout for operations |
| Screenshots | /tmp/ | Saved to temp directory |
How It Works
- Describe what you want to test or automate
- Claude writes custom Playwright code for the task
- Universal executor (run.js) runs it with proper module resolution
- Browser opens (visible by default) and automation executes
- Results displayed with console output and screenshots

Troubleshooting
| Issue | Solution |
|---|---|
| Playwright not installed | Run npm run setup in skill directory |
| Module not found | Ensure automation runs via run.js |
| Browser doesn't open | Verify headless: false is set |
| Need other browsers | Run npm run install-all-browsers |
Dependencies
- Node.js
- Playwright (installed via setup)
- Chromium (installed via setup)
